Prerequisite: CRIMIN 1100, and 3 hours of philosophy or consent of instructor. Same as PHIL 4920. An examination of typical problems raised by law, including the basis of legal obligations and rights, relations between law and morality, the logic of legal reasoning, and the justification for punishment. This is a variable content course and may be taken again for credit with consent of instructor and department chair.
